Empecher le spam de formulaire php ?


philouseb
WRInaute impliqué
WRInaute impliqué
 
Messages: 661
Inscription: 2 Nov 2006

Message le Mar Juil 29, 2008 8:45

Bonjour,

J'ai une erreur :

Parse error: syntax error, unexpected T_STRING, expecting ',' or ';' in mail.php on line 19


OTP
Modérateur
Modérateur
 
Messages: 19375
Inscription: 16 Déc 2005

Message le Mar Juil 29, 2008 9:09

C'est quoi ta ligne 19 ?


philouseb
WRInaute impliqué
WRInaute impliqué
 
Messages: 661
Inscription: 2 Nov 2006

Message le Mar Juil 29, 2008 9:23

Sur ma ligne 19 il y a juste : else

Je précise que j'ai copié ton code sans changement...


OTP
Modérateur
Modérateur
 
Messages: 19375
Inscription: 16 Déc 2005

Message le Mar Juil 29, 2008 9:29

Il y a une double quote en trop dans le dernier echo mais ça ne doit pas expliquer cette erreur. Essaie quand même (je vais corriger plus haut).


philouseb
WRInaute impliqué
WRInaute impliqué
 
Messages: 661
Inscription: 2 Nov 2006

Message le Mar Juil 29, 2008 9:34

Ca marche... Merci

Il suffit de pas grand chose...


OTP
Modérateur
Modérateur
 
Messages: 19375
Inscription: 16 Déc 2005

Message le Mar Juil 29, 2008 9:36

Tant mieux, je n'y croyais pas trop. Cette erreur vient du fait que j'ai simplifié le code pour l'exemple et un peu oublié un ".


philouseb
WRInaute impliqué
WRInaute impliqué
 
Messages: 661
Inscription: 2 Nov 2006

Message le Mar Juil 29, 2008 9:37

Merci encore


philouseb
WRInaute impliqué
WRInaute impliqué
 
Messages: 661
Inscription: 2 Nov 2006

Message le Jeu Juil 31, 2008 10:17

oli004 a écrit:
J'utilise une variante de ce principe sur mes divers formulaires. La différence est que je cache le champs à tester par un display none via css et je verifie si le champs est vide avant d'envoyer le formulaire.

Je suis parti du principe que les robots remplissent systematiquement les champs avec du contenu aleatoire.
Hors un humain lui, ne voyant pas le champs de test, ben.... il ne le rempli pas.

DOnc si le champs de test est vide > j'envoie le formulaire, et si il est renseigné, je n'envoie rien.

Cette solution fonctionne pour moi depuis plus d'un an sur plusieurs sites.



Salut, puis-je te demander tes sources aussi afin d'avoir une variante...

Merci d'avance

Empecher le spam de formulaire php ?

Si vous avez aimé cette discussion, partagez-la sur vos réseaux sociaux préférés :

Lectures recommandées sur ce thème :



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invités